New Broad Street Property to be Mix of Retail, Residential, Public Space

ATHENS  If you haven’t heard of 315 Oconee Street, you will soon.

More apartments combined with retail space is in the building process. “The Mark” will be the next student-apartment complex to make its mark on the downtown Athens skyline.

The nearly 10 acre property was purchased by Landmark Properties. After a failed attempt to insert a Walmart into downtown Athens, Landmark has redone its plans and is building a student housing complex.

Landmark detonated an explosion on its property.

The proposed plan details a rooftop pool, bedrooms accommodating two to five roommates and two parking decks. The planners are also proposing a road through the middle of each building connecting Broad Street to Oconee Street and the Greenway Trails.

Although these massive student residence spaces seem to be the trend in Athens, not all students are happy with them. Senior Danimarie Roselle says she is not used to seeing the Athens skyline constantly change.
